Temperature Comparison in September

Hong Kong reaches an average high of 29°C (84°F) and drops to 25°C (77°F) at night during September. The daily temperature range is 4°C, meaning relatively stable temperatures from day to night.

Guangzhou averages 30°C (86°F) for the high and 24°C (75°F) for the low, with a daily range of 6°C. The two cities feel quite similar in terms of temperature.

Both cities are in the Northern Hemisphere, so they share the same seasonal pattern in September.

Rainfall Comparison in September

Hong Kong receives approximately 215 mm of rainfall across 17 rain days during September. Rain is frequent, so waterproof gear is essential.

Guangzhou sees 180 mm over 16 rain days. That makes Guangzhou the drier option by 1 rain day and 35 mm of total precipitation.

Year-Round Comparison: Hong Kong vs Guangzhou

The table below shows average high temperatures and rain days for every month of the year, helping you find the best time to visit either city.September is highlighted for quick reference.

MonthHong KongGuangzhou
HighRainHighRain
Jan19°C4d19°C7d
Feb20°C6d20°C10d
Mar22°C10d23°C15d
Apr25°C14d27°C18d
May28°C20d29°C22d
Jun29°C24d31°C24d
Jul30°C24d32°C23d
Aug30°C24d32°C24d
Sep29°C17d30°C16d
Oct27°C7d28°C6d
Nov24°C5d25°C6d
Dec20°C4d20°C5d

Climate data sourced from the Open-Meteo Historical Weather API, using ERA5 reanalysis data covering 30-year normals from 1991 to 2020. All temperatures shown in Celsius with Fahrenheit equivalents. Rain days count days with 1 mm or more of precipitation. Sunshine hours represent average daily values. This comparison is generated from long-term climate averages and individual trips may vary.
